    Hello avid adventurers, I am Jake your Dungoen Master, welcome to the beautiful world of Dungeons and Dragons. For those of you new to D&D, this is a story driven fantasy game, where a Dungeon Master, or “DM”, will narrate a fictional world and players will role play characters within the world. Players must overcome a variety of challenges, set by the DM, such as puzzles; traps and fights, in order to progress further in the story. They do this by rolling a multitude of dice and using their wit and improvisation skills to stay alive.

    Giant Robot was a bi-monthly magazine of Asian and Asian American popular culture founded in 1994. It was initially created as a small, punk-minded magazine that featured Asian pop culture and Asian American alternative culture, including such varied subject matter as history, art, music, film, books, toys, technology and more. Currently, Giant Robot operates a shop on Sawtelle Blvd and a Gallery (GR2) also on Sawtelle Blvd.
